aebrahim: Linux 2003-10-27 GCC 3.3.2 XFT/GTK2 Pentium4/SSE2

Discussion about official Mozilla Firefox builds
Post Reply
aebrahim
Posts: 1234
Joined: November 10th, 2002, 2:47 am
Location: Hong Kong
Contact:

aebrahim: Linux 2003-10-27 GCC 3.3.2 XFT/GTK2 Pentium4/SSE2

Post by aebrahim »

I've compiled Firebird on Linux using GCC 3.3.2 with XFT and GTK2 for the Pentium 4 with SSE2 optimisations. I compiled this build using Fedora Core 0.95. The build is here:

http://pryan.org/firebird/aebrahim/Mozi ... e2.tar.bz2 (8.4MB)

I used the following .mozconfig to build:

. $topsrcdir/browser/config/mozconfig
ac_add_options --disable-tests
ac_add_options --disable-debug
ac_add_options --enable-optimize="-O3 -march=pentium4 -mfpmath=sse -msse2"
ac_add_options --enable-xft
ac_add_options --enable-default-toolkit=gtk2

This is my first attempt at a Linux build, so please bear with any problems that you might have (though it works fine for me). :)
User avatar
TeddyBerlin
Posts: 340
Joined: August 10th, 2003, 9:53 am
Location: Berlin(Germany)
Contact:

Post by TeddyBerlin »

Will it also give a SSE-build(Athlon XP)?

Heinrich Witt
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.7b) Gecko/20040309 Firefox/0.8.0+
Mozilla Thunderbird 0.5+ (20040304)
VILLA21
Posts: 116
Joined: August 13th, 2003, 12:00 am
Location: Greece

Post by VILLA21 »

Oh, thanks, glad to see u making builds for Linux. I will try it on Mandrake 9.1 as soon as i go back home.
:)
sontjer
Posts: 1
Joined: October 8th, 2003, 10:12 pm
Location: Shanghai, China

Post by sontjer »

It's very nice to have you here in linux area! I'm sure more linuxers out there would like to thank you too. I'll try it on my own.
What if god was one of us...
User avatar
slippytoad
Posts: 90
Joined: November 4th, 2002, 5:52 pm
Location: Mountain View, CA
Contact:

Post by slippytoad »

Excellent build - thanks!
User avatar
Tanner
Posts: 63
Joined: October 4th, 2003, 9:50 am
Location: Montefiore Conca (Rimini - Italy)
Contact:

Post by Tanner »

Why is the Linux build so bigger than Win32 build?
Only for curiosity :)
aebrahim
Posts: 1234
Joined: November 10th, 2002, 2:47 am
Location: Hong Kong
Contact:

Post by aebrahim »

TeddyBerlin wrote:Will it also give a SSE-build(Athlon XP)?

Heinrich Witt

No, on Linux its easy enough to roll your own build (I'm a relative newbie to Linux and still managed it without problems), so I'm not going to spend time making customised builds for plaforms that I'm not using myself.
aebrahim
Posts: 1234
Joined: November 10th, 2002, 2:47 am
Location: Hong Kong
Contact:

Post by aebrahim »

Tanner wrote:Why is the Linux build so bigger than Win32 build?
Only for curiosity :)

The Linux build is a dynamic build, which increases the size a little bit. I'm not sure why it's so much bigger. I guess that's just the way it is. :) Can anyone else be more specific than I?
User avatar
UIQ19
Posts: 38
Joined: September 25th, 2003, 10:29 am
Location: San Benedetto Po - Italy
Contact:

What about your Win32 build?

Post by UIQ19 »

Please [-o< [-o< [-o<
UIQ19
Post Reply